Contrary to popular belief, eye color is not determined by a single dominant gene. The appearance of green results from a precise combination of different hereditary factors, with just enough melanin to create this luminous hue with sometimes golden undertones… A true miracle of genetics!

A palette of shifting shades.
A striking characteristic: the green color of the irises can change depending on lighting conditions or even emotional state. On overcast days, it can turn a deep hazel, while in full sunlight, it reveals jade or emerald hues. This phenomenon is explained by the unique structure of the stroma, the membrane of the eye that reflects light. Thus, each pair of green eyes offers a unique and constantly evolving spectacle, like a mineral chameleon.
